I am a current Zecco Trading account holder.  I have been using Zecco for awhile.  I signed up for Zecco to open an account to buy and sell subpenny stocks.  I was fine and happy with everything for a while.  I'm not talking about trading just a couple of hundred dollars.  My account had a couple of thousand.  Thus, with subpenny stocks you can imagine I held millions of subpenny stocks from many different companies. 

Enters the reason I would stay away from Zecco Trading.  If you Google Zecco Trading you will find many stories about all thier "fees" and "surprise fees."  Zecco Trading mid year introduced a new fees for stocks traded on the pinksheets (subpenny stocks) of up to $700 fee per order.  So, now that I hold $100 of a certain stock (1,000,000 shares) I can no longer trade it on Zecco Trading without risking a fee of up to $700 for a $100 order.  Make any sense? 

So, now me and so many other thousands of Zecco stock traders have to hold our stocks or risk Zecco $700 fee.  As you can imagine most are holding...but these stocks may end up just going away...anyway (common market for subpenny) but it's not at our discretion.  It's take loss of all the subpenny stocks we hold or pay Zecco up $700 per order that they put through to process the sale of your subpenny stocks.  And for an order to sell a 1,000,000 share may occur over 4 to 7 orders.

Stay away from Zecco Trading.  Use Sharebuilder or Etrade or some other company.  I am just waiting for someone to hopefully begin a successful class action law suit against Zecco Trading.
